Andrew P. Carpenter Tax Act - Amends the Internal Revenue Code to: (1) exclude from the gross income of any cosigner of a student loan of a veteran who died as a result of a service-connected disability any amount attributable to the discharge of the indebtedness on such loan, and (2) subject accounts in the Thrift Savings Fund to a federal tax levy. Provides that any potential revenue gain from the enactment of this Act shall be deposited in the general fund of the Treasury and shall be used solely for deficit reduction.
